What city in Georgia has the highest crime rate?
Click here to see the most dangerous cities in Georgia
Rather, College Park, a small city of roughly 15,000 on Atlanta’s outskirts, grabbed the top spot. Perhaps its small population skewed the results, which totaled 267 for violent crimes and 934 for property offenses.

Which county in Georgia has the lowest crime rate?
The small city of Holly Springs in Cherokee County earns the title of Georgia’s safest. Holly Springs violent crime rate of 1.03 per 1K and property crime rate of 12.36 per 1K are considerably below both national and state averages.
Is Georgia a dangerous state?
With an overall score of 40.91, Georgia’s the country’s ninth-most dangerous state. Georgia ranks 50th for Financial Safety and 44th for Road Safety; however, Georgia ranks significantly better for Personal & Residential Safety at 25th. Georgia has the fourth-highest share of uninsured people.
